R.H. Bluestein & Co's Q3 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2015, R.H. Bluestein & Co held 344 positions worth $1.41B, down 15% from $1.65B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 32% of the portfolio.

R.H. Bluestein & Co withdrew a net $148M in Q3 2015, closing 42 positions and reducing 110 holdings. Its most notable exit was United Rentals, an estimated $19.1M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 18% of assets, down from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Healthcare.

Against the trend, R.H. Bluestein & Co opened a new position in CVS Health worth $25.4M.
